    The Cincinnati Enquirer considers undrafted rookie LB Jayson DiManche the most likely UDFA to crack the Bengals’ 53-man roster.
    DiManche’s $15,000 signing bonus was tied for the second highest amongst all undrafted free agents, while the Bengals have a history of rostering UDFA linebackers. A quick-twitch pass-rusher for small-school Southern Illinois, DiManche racked up 38 tackles for loss and 16.5 sacks in three college seasons. “He’s such a good athlete,” coach Marvin Lewis said. “He’s got the long legs, long arms. But he’s so underdeveloped physically. That’s what you’re looking for: A guy with the physical upside.”

    Browns signed LB Jayson DiManche off the Chiefs’ practice squad.
    A former “name” undrafted free agent, DiManche made 28 appearances between 2013-14, and has experience on defense. He’ll be a special teamer for the Browns.

    Bengals placed LB Jayson DiManche (broken forearm) on injured reserve, ending his season.
    DiManche hasn’t played a defensive snap since Week 7, but is a core and strong special teamer. The 2013 UDFA out of Southern Illinois will be in a fight for a roster spot in 2015.
